Lightning is a natural electrical discharge that occurs during thunderstorms. It is formed when there is a buildup of static electricity in the atmosphere, and the discharge seeks to equalize the charges. This discharge can reach temperatures of up to 30,000 degrees Fahrenheit (16,666 degrees Celsius) and travel at speeds of over 220,000 miles per hour (354,000 kilometers per hour). Given its powerful nature, it is no surprise that lightning can cause severe damage to electronic devices.

Despite the risks, there are ways to minimize the chances of lightning striking your electronics. One of the most effective methods is to unplug devices from power outlets during a thunderstorm. This will prevent any electrical surge from reaching your gadgets. Additionally, it is advisable to use surge protectors for devices that need to remain plugged in. Surge protectors can help absorb excess voltage and protect your electronics from damage.
Another way to safeguard your electronics is to keep them away from windows and exterior walls. Lightning can enter a building through these openings, so keeping your devices in a safe, interior location can reduce the risk of damage. Furthermore, installing a lightning rod or surge protection system for your home can also provide an additional layer of protection.
